Coupa Supplier Management
enterpriseManages supplier onboarding, performance tracking, and risk workflows through a unified supplier management module.
Coupa Supplier Management questionnaires and onboarding workflows with supplier collaboration and status tracking
Coupa Supplier Management stands out for its supplier collaboration workflow tightly integrated with Coupa’s spend and procurement suite. The product supports supplier onboarding, performance and risk management, and structured data collection through configurable supplier questionnaires and workflows. It also emphasizes guided collaboration with approvals and status tracking for documents, content, and compliance activities across the supplier lifecycle.
Pros
- End-to-end supplier onboarding with configurable workflows and structured data capture
- Strong collaboration with approval trails and supplier status visibility
- Supplier risk and performance processes aligned to procurement and spend management
- Centralized supplier records reduce reliance on spreadsheets and email threads
- Configurable questionnaires standardize compliance and data requirements
Cons
- Advanced setup and configuration require process mapping and governance
- Supplier-side experience can depend on integration maturity and data readiness
- Deep customization can increase administrative overhead for nonstandard workflows
- Reporting flexibility may require careful configuration to match internal metrics
Best For
Enterprises consolidating supplier onboarding, compliance, and performance into Coupa workflows
SAP Business Network
networkConnects enterprises with suppliers for supplier collaboration, onboarding, document exchange, and procurement workflows.
Integrated supplier collaboration and electronic document exchange for procure-to-pay workflows
SAP Business Network stands out by connecting trading partners through a shared network layer integrated with SAP supply chain and ERP processes. Core supplier management capabilities include supplier collaboration, document exchange for procure-to-pay workflows, and centralized supplier onboarding and master data-related coordination. The platform also supports automated workflows around orders and invoices, reducing manual back-and-forth with suppliers. Its strength centers on networked procurement execution rather than standalone supplier portals with deeply customized catalogs and workflows.
Pros
- Strong supplier collaboration built for networked procure-to-pay document flows
- Tight integration with SAP ERP improves consistency of supplier and transaction data
- Scales partner participation with standardized workflows and shared communication
Cons
- Supplier portal experiences depend heavily on integration and partner setup
- Less suited for highly bespoke supplier onboarding workflows without SAP expertise
- Change management can be heavy for organizations with complex procurement variations
Best For
Enterprises standardizing supplier collaboration and EDI-like document exchange on SAP-centric processes

What Is Supplier Management Portal Software?
Supplier Management Portal Software runs structured supplier onboarding, ongoing compliance intake, and supplier collaboration workflows inside a governed portal experience. It replaces email and spreadsheet coordination with configurable questionnaires, document collection, approvals, and status tracking across the supplier lifecycle. Procurement-focused products like Coupa Supplier Management and SAP Business Network connect supplier collaboration to procure-to-pay activities and internal workflows so supplier data updates flow into procurement execution.
